I've followed up with Dell and you should already have the latest firmware loaded on your Dell dock. Some further thoughts: Do you see this with other browsers or just when using Chrome? If it is Chrome specific can you try these steps? Click on the Customize and Control Google Chrome button > Settings Scroll down and click on "Show Advanced settings" In the Privacy section, uncheck "Predict network actions to improve page load performance".
